
The boundary between Otter Tail and Douglas counties bisects a landscape defined by an intricate network of glacial lakes and agricultural drainage. This northern Minnesota terrain is dominated by the sprawling waters of Lake Miltona and Lake Ida, where points of interest like Betsy Ross Point and Christopherson Bay define the southern shoreline. The small settlement of Leaf Valley sits at a crossroads in the center of the map, serving as a local hub for the surrounding farmsteads and lakeside properties.
